Monte do Carmo and Figueirópolis, side by side
Per resident, in the latest year both declared to the National Treasury (2024). Each line is a government function, as each município declares it.
Per resident in 2024
Monte do Carmo (TO)5,667 residents (2025)Figueirópolis (TO)5,334 residents (2025)
Spending paidR$ 7.110R$ 7.030
Net revenueR$ 7.805R$ 7.464
EducaçãoR$ 2.263R$ 1.613
SaúdeR$ 1.827R$ 1.658
AdministraçãoR$ 658R$ 983
UrbanismoR$ 236R$ 765
Gestão AmbientalR$ 189R$ 599
TransporteR$ 508R$ 131
Assistência SocialR$ 350R$ 252
Previdência SocialR$ 342R$ 281
LegislativaR$ 270R$ 336
CulturaR$ 243R$ 79
AgriculturaR$ 116R$ 82
Indústria—R$ 114
Desporto e LazerR$ 42R$ 84
TrabalhoR$ 64—
Encargos Especiais—R$ 52
Comércio e Serviços—R$ 1
Segurança PúblicaR$ 1—

How to read this comparison
The amounts are the spending paid (and the net revenue realised) divided by the population IBGE estimates, in the same year for both. A function missing on one side is one that município did not declare that year, not a zero. Municípios of very different sizes have different structures: two of similar population say more.
Source: SICONFI, National Treasury (DCA, Annexes I-C and I-E); population IBGE. Per resident, year 2024.
